Drainage Solutions We Install

  • French Drains — gravel-filled trenches with perforated pipe that collect and redirect underground water

  • Channel Drains — surface drains for driveways, patios, and other hard surfaces where water pools

  • Dry Creek Beds — decorative rock channels that move water naturally while adding visual appeal

  • Downspout Extensions — underground piping that carries roof runoff away from your foundation

  • Grading & Swales — reshaping the ground to create natural water flow paths

  • Catch Basins — collection points that capture surface water and route it through underground pipes

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a French drain cost?

French drain costs depend on the length and depth of the system. Most residential French drains run between $1,500 and $5,000. We provide a detailed estimate after evaluating your property and the scope of the drainage problem.

Will a French drain fix my standing water?

In most cases, yes. French drains are the most effective solution for subsurface water that pools in yards. For surface water, we may recommend a combination of grading, channel drains, and French drains.

How long does drainage installation take?

Most residential drainage projects take one to three days. A simple downspout extension can be done in a few hours. A full French drain system across a backyard takes two to three days.
